Someone on our team raised concerns about using both oracle table level partitioning and SAN striping. As I have said before I am more on the developer side of things. Has anyone had problems with this?

"SAN striping of data file and Oracle partitions) techniques we are using will sure collide with each other creating worse performance than using either one of the two. Since SAN is not aware of how oracle is handling the partitions, data from two hash or range partitions can end up on the same spindle thereby making it serial I/O."
